Machine Learning: The Power Behind AI

Machine learning is a subset of AI that allows computers to gain knowledge from data and improve their performance over time. This approach is revolutionizing various industries by enabling predictive analytics, natural language processing, and picture recognition. Through machine learning, we can solve complex problems that were previously impossible to tackle manually. For example, machine learning algorithms can analyze vast amounts of data to predict future trends with unprecedented accuracy.

Key Applications:

Predictive Analytics: Machine learning models can forecast future events, such as market trends, consumer behavior, and even the likelihood of certain illnesses. Natural Language Processing (NLP): AI systems can understand and generate human language, facilitating better customer service, improved virtual assistants, and advanced chatbots. Picture Recognition: Image recognition technology enables AI to identify objects, faces, and patterns in images and videos, which is crucial for security and navigation systems.

AI in Various Sectors

The impact of AI is being felt across multiple sectors, from border control to education, robotics, enterprise, and the automotive industry. Here are some specific areas where AI is making a significant difference:

Machine Learning in Border Control

AI technologies are being used to automate border control processes, enhancing security and efficiency. Facial recognition, biometric screening, and predictive analytics can quickly identify potential threats and track suspicious activities. These systems are designed to work seamlessly with existing infrastructure, making them a valuable addition to border security measures.

AI in Education

AI is transforming the education sector by providing personalized learning experiences, automating administrative tasks, and enhancing instructional methods. Adaptive learning algorithms can tailor lesson plans and assessments to individual student needs, ensuring that every learner receives the support they require. Additionally, AI-driven tools can help teachers manage their workload, freeing up time for more meaningful interactions with students.

Robots and Autonomy

Robots powered by AI are becoming more prevalent in both industrial and consumer settings. Industrial robots perform repetitive tasks with precision, while service robots assist in healthcare, hospitality, and domestic settings. Autonomous vehicles, guided by AI, promise to revolutionize transportation by making it safer and more efficient. AI in Enterprises

AI technologies are also being integrated into enterprises to optimize operations, improve decision-making, and drive innovation. Predictive maintenance, supply chain optimization, and customer relationship management are just a few of the applications that can significantly enhance business performance. By leveraging machine learning, companies can stay ahead of the competition and respond to market changes more effectively.

AI in the Automotive Industry

The automotive industry is experiencing a profound transformation with the integration of AI. Autonomous vehicles, equipped with advanced sensors and machine learning algorithms, can navigate complex environments with minimal human intervention. This has the potential to reduce accidents, lower insurance costs, and improve traffic flow. Additionally, AI enhances vehicle design and manufacturing processes, leading to more fuel-efficient and sustainable vehicles.

AI in Traffic Management

AI is playing a crucial role in optimizing traffic flow and managing urban infrastructure. Traffic management systems can dynamically adjust signal timings, coordinate public transportation, and predict congestion hotspots. These solutions not only reduce travel time and improve air quality but also enhance the overall urban living experience.
